Dickinson Museum Center in Dickinson, ND offers a diverse and engaging experience for visitors on its 12-acre campus, featuring the Badlands Dinosaur Museum, Joachim Regional History Museum, Pioneer Machinery Hall, and Prairie Outpost Park. The museum showcases a range of exhibits, including local history displays and a collection of dinosaur artifacts, providing a fun and educational environment for families and individuals alike.
Visitors can explore the past through interactive displays and hands-on experiences, such as touching actual dinosaur bones and enjoying augmented reality activities. With seasonal opportunities like the Paleontology Assistant job position and special events like the North Dakota Juried Student Art Show, Dickinson Museum Center continues to captivate guests with its rich history and engaging exhibits.
